在网页设计中,边框阴影是常用的视觉效果之一,它可以增加元素的立体感和层次感。然而,在某些情况下,边框阴影可能会造成视觉干扰,影响页面的美观度。本文将介绍几种方法,帮助您在HTML5中快速去除边框阴影,提升页面美观度。

1. CSS样式去除边框阴影

最简单的方法是通过CSS样式去除边框阴影。以下是一些常用的CSS属性,可以用来控制边框阴影:

1.1 box-shadow属性

box-shadow属性可以用来添加边框阴影,也可以用来去除边框阴影。以下是一个去除边框阴影的例子:

/* 去除边框阴影 */
.element {
  box-shadow: none;
}

1.2 border属性

通过设置border属性为0,可以去除元素的边框,从而去除边框阴影。以下是一个去除边框的例子:

/* 去除边框 */
.element {
  border: 0;
}

1.3 outline属性

outline属性可以用来添加或去除元素的轮廓线,轮廓线有时会被误认为是边框阴影。以下是一个去除轮廓线的例子:

/* 去除轮廓线 */
.element {
  outline: none;
}

2. HTML5标签和属性

除了CSS样式,HTML5标签和属性也可以用来去除边框阴影。

2.1 <button>标签

使用<button>标签创建按钮时,默认会有边框和阴影。可以通过CSS样式去除它们:

<button class="element">点击我</button>

<style>
  .element {
    border: 0;
    box-shadow: none;
  }
</style>

2.2 type属性

<input><select><textarea>等表单元素中,可以通过设置type属性为button来创建无边框、无阴影的按钮样式:

<input type="button" value="点击我" class="element">

3. 去除图片边框阴影

图片边框阴影可以通过CSS样式去除。以下是一个去除图片边框阴影的例子:

/* 去除图片边框阴影 */
.img-element {
  border: 0;
  box-shadow: none;
}

4. 总结

去除HTML5中的边框阴影有多种方法,您可以根据实际情况选择合适的方法。通过合理运用CSS样式和HTML5标签,可以快速去除边框阴影,提升页面美观度。